Tile flooring needs to look refined and perform under daily foot traffic. SHAX Family Tile installs porcelain, ceramic, stone-look, concrete-look, wood-look, and large-format tile floors for bathrooms, kitchens, living areas, entries, laundry rooms, and whole-home upgrades across San Diego County.
Floor tile installation starts before any tile is opened. We look at substrate condition, height transitions, doorways, cabinets, baseboards, room shape, and the direction the tile should run. Large-format porcelain is popular because it creates a clean modern look, but it also requires attention to floor flatness. A floor that seems acceptable for small tile may not be ready for larger pieces or tight grout joints. Planning helps reduce lippage, awkward cuts, and transitions that feel like an afterthought.

Porcelain is a strong choice for San Diego tile floors because it is durable, available in many finishes, and practical for busy homes. Wood-look porcelain can bring warmth without the same moisture concerns as real wood in kitchens or bathrooms. Stone-look porcelain offers the visual character of marble, limestone, or travertine with easier maintenance. Natural stone floors can be beautiful, but they need realistic expectations around sealing and variation. A great floor feels consistent as you walk through the space. We pay attention to the first layout lines, perimeter cuts, spacing, leveling, doorway transitions, movement joints, and the relationship between tile and baseboards or cabinets. In open spaces, the floor can become a major design feature; in smaller rooms, it has to make the space feel clean instead of crowded. The goal is a durable floor that looks planned, not forced into the room.
Tile is permanent enough that shortcuts stay visible. A poor layout can leave small cuts in the wrong place, a rushed surface can create lippage, and the wrong edge plan can make an expensive tile look unfinished. Surface preparation is central to tile flooring. We evaluate the floor before setting so larger tile and tight joints have the support they need.
Tile direction, grout width, movement joints, and transitions are selected for both appearance and long-term use.
Kitchens, entries, baths, and living areas need transitions that feel smooth and intentional, especially when tile meets other flooring.
